Pakistan: Contraceptives Are Un-Islamic
A report from India's Kerala News announces that Pakistan's clerics have turned down the government's request to use loudspeakers to deliver sermons advocating birth control.
The proposal had been suggested by Pakistan's Population Welfare Department, and would have given honorary awards to the clerics in exchange for supporting the use of birth control in sermons.
A meeting was held on Tuesday, presided over by Maulana Abdul Majid Nadeem, secretary general of the Aamli Majlis Tahaffuz Khatm-e-Nabuwat, with representatives of other groups also present. The conference decided that the proposal was un-Islamic and said thatm should it be enacted, it would breed sexual corruption, vulgarity and other evils in Pakistani society. They further suggested that the Pakistan government should abolish it Population Welfare Department, because "it had no place in an Islamic society".
